PROJECT: Construct a standard-design barracks complex. (Current Mission) REQUIREMENT: This project is required to provide living and working conditions for soldiers that meet current standards. The maximum barracks utilization is 336 soldiers. CURRENT SITUATION: Modernization of existing barracks has reduced their capacity, which has created a need for a new barracks. The existing operational and administrative facilities are too small and have inefficient layouts. IMPACT IF NOT PROVIDED: If this project is not provided, soldiers will continue to live and work in substandard and deteriorated facilities, which will adversely impact morale, retention, and readiness. ADDITIONAL: This project has been coordinated with the installation physical security plan, and all required physical security measures are included. All required anti-terrorism/force protection measures are included. An economic analysis has been prepared and utilized in evaluating this project, the result of which is that of the two feasible options, renovation of existing facilities or construction of new facilities, new construction would be less expensive over the life of the project. Sustainable principles will be integrated into the design, development, and construction of the project in accordance with Executive Order 13123 and other applicable laws and Executive Orders. The Deputy Assistant Secretary of the Army (Installations and Housing) certifies that this project has been considered for joint use potential. The facility will be available for use by other components. During the past two years, about $7M has been spent on sustainment, restoration, and modernization (SRM) of unaccompanied enlisted personnel housing at Fort Stewart, GA. Upon completion of this multi-phased project, and other projects approved or budgeted through FY 2005, there will be no remaining unaccompanied enlisted permanent party deficit at this installation.
